    How busy is it in February Half Term?

    Does anyone know what the weather is like in February, and also, are the parks very busy during Feb Half Term?

    We were there for half term in February this year as well. We did have one fairly cold day although it was still bright and sunny and most of the week we were in T-shirts and shorts during the day.

    As far as queues went it was better than I expected it to be. From memory I think the longest we queued for anything was about 30 minutes which was The Mummy at Universal.

    We went to all the Disney & Universal parks and didn't really wait long anywhere. In fact at Islands of Adventure it was very quiet and when we went to Jurassic Park we had one of the boats to ourselves!
